Albanian Ambassador: Berisha wants Tadic to visit Tirana

03. August 2010. | 07:56 08:01

Source: Beta, Danas

Albanian Ambassador in Belgrade Shpetim Chaushi has said that Albania and Serbia are now closely cooperating to develop relations and that this is producing a positive effect on relations in the entire region.

In an interview with the Aug. 2 edition of Danas, Chaushi said that Albanian Prime Minister Sali Berisha had invited Serbian President Boris Tadic to pay Albania an official visit.

He said that Albanian Deputy Prime Minister and Foreign Minister Ilir Meta's visit to Belgrade was an historically important political indicator which would undoubtedly play a role in the latest development of relations between the two states.
